The Portland Timbers kick things off early today as they face off against the Vancouver Whitecaps up in British Columbia. With both sides below the red line so far this season, both the Timbers and the Whitecaps will be looking to move up the standings today.

More than just moving up the table, however, this is a Cascadia Cup match between two rival sides. With the Timbers having raised the MLS Cup at the end of last season, the Whitecaps are the only Cascadian side without any major hardware since making the move to MLS and will be coming out with something to prove against the champs.

Preview Interview: "The better Laba is, the better the Whitecaps are, simple as that. Unfortunately, he isn't having his best season as a Whitecap, and that's showed with the results that we have been getting. He plays as a defensice midfelder, which is a vital position to the Whitecaps style of play. Our league leading defense last year was largely due to Laba putting in the hours disrupting attacks, and being in the right position to stop whatever other teams would throw at us. On the flip side, going forward we needed someone who could create breaks by playing with Morales in the midfield, and he was more than adept at that."
